net.minecraft.server.network

public class ServerLoginPacketListenerImpl

implements TickablePacketListener, ServerLoginPacketListener

ahb
net.minecraft.server.network.ServerLoginPacketListenerImpl
net.minecraft.class_3248
net.minecraft.unmapped.C_rktsiyfy
net.minecraft.server.network.ServerLoginNetworkHandler
net.minecraft.server.network.ServerLoginNetworkHandler
net.minecraft.src.C_37_
net.minecraft.server.network.LoginListener

Field summary

Modifier and TypeField
private static final AtomicInteger
b
UNIQUE_THREAD_ID
field_14157
f_krozceue
NEXT_AUTHENTICATOR_THREAD_ID
NEXT_AUTHENTICATOR_THREAD_ID
f_10014_
static final org.slf4j.Logger
c
LOGGER
field_14166
f_vpcbiggs
LOGGER
LOGGER
f_10015_
private static final int
d
MAX_TICKS_BEFORE_LOGIN
field_29779
f_qcawoghx
TIMEOUT_TICKS
TIMEOUT_TICKS
f_143698_
private static final RandomSource
e
RANDOM
field_14164
f_jtougkjq
RANDOM
RANDOM
f_10016_
private static final Component
f
MISSING_PROFILE_PUBLIC_KEY
field_39020
f_ztwhqapz
MISSING_PUBLIC_KEY_TEXT
f_ztwhqapz
f_215252_
private static final Component
g
INVALID_SIGNATURE
field_39021
f_jeqynamo
INVALID_PUBLIC_KEY_SIGNATURE_TEXT
f_jeqynamo
f_215253_
private static final Component
h
INVALID_PUBLIC_KEY
field_39022
f_jpdnzjip
INVALID_PUBLIC_KEY_TEXT
f_jpdnzjip
f_215254_
private final byte[]
i
nonce
field_14167
f_hzaimjtn
nonce
nonce
f_10017_
final MinecraftServer
j
server
field_14162
f_ckpkjeza
server
server
f_10018_
public final Connection
a
connection
field_14158
f_rnobeveb
connection
connection
f_10013_
ServerLoginPacketListenerImpl$State
k
state
field_14163
f_wbgiazuc
state
state
f_10019_
private int
l
tick
field_14156
f_dosbbvgm
loginTicks
loginTicks
f_10020_
com.mojang.authlib.GameProfile
m
gameProfile
field_14160
f_qqucyfys
profile
profile
f_10021_
private final String
n
serverId
field_14165
f_kankoaiw
serverId
serverId
f_10022_
private ServerPlayer
o
delayedAcceptPlayer
field_14161
f_kuxzahap
delayedPlayer
delayedPlayer
f_10024_
private ProfilePublicKey$Data
p
profilePublicKeyData
field_39743
f_qwwoxxrr
publicKeyData
f_qwwoxxrr
f_240234_

Constructor summary

ModifierConstructor
public (MinecraftServer server, Connection connection)

Method summary

Modifier and TypeMethod
public void
c()
tick()
method_18784()
m_rpfiixll()
tick()
m_rpfiixll()
m_9933_()
public Connection
a()
getConnection()
method_2872()
m_pbrzbpgd()
getConnection()
getConnection()
m_6198_()
public void
b(rq arg0)
disconnect(Component arg0)
method_14380(class_2561 arg0)
m_mfmegsst(C_rdaqiwdt arg0)
disconnect(Text reason)
disconnect(Text reason)
m_10053_(C_4996_ arg0)
public void
d()
handleAcceptedLogin()
method_14384()
m_thahtwjt()
acceptPlayer()
acceptPlayer()
m_10055_()
private void
a(agh arg0)
placeNewPlayer(ServerPlayer arg0)
method_33800(class_3222 arg0)
m_zxhkspyr(C_mxrobsgg arg0)
addToServer(ServerPlayerEntity player)
addToServer(ServerPlayerEntity player)
m_143699_(C_13_ arg0)
public void
a(rq arg0)
onDisconnect(Component arg0)
method_10839(class_2561 arg0)
m_wtlhyems(C_rdaqiwdt arg0)
onDisconnected(Text arg0)
onDisconnected(Text arg0)
m_7026_(C_4996_ arg0)
public String
e()
getUserName()
method_14383()
m_roysjhxy()
getConnectionInfo()
getConnectionInfo()
m_10056_()
private static ProfilePublicKey
a(buf$a arg0, UUID arg1, amp arg2, boolean arg3)
validatePublicKey(ProfilePublicKey$Data arg0, UUID arg1, SignatureValidator arg2, boolean arg3)
method_43510(class_7428$class_7443 arg0, UUID arg1, class_7500 arg2, boolean arg3)
m_roqwsmck(C_psbzgaqf$C_aheynfty arg0, UUID arg1, C_yvuwcvkm arg2, boolean arg3)
getVerifiedPublicKey(PlayerPublicKey$PublicKeyData publicKeyData, UUID playerUuid, SignatureVerifier servicesSignatureVerifier, boolean shouldThrowOnMissingKey)
m_roqwsmck(PlayerPublicKey$Data arg0, UUID arg1, SignatureValidator arg2, boolean arg3)
m_215256_(C_213071_ p_240244_, UUID p_240245_, C_212977_ p_240246_, boolean p_240247_)
public void
a(zx arg0)
handleHello(ServerboundHelloPacket arg0)
method_12641(class_2915 arg0)
m_epdhoxrd(C_jfswawnu arg0)
onHello(LoginHelloC2SPacket arg0)
onHello(LoginHelloC2SPacket arg0)
m_5990_(C_5211_ arg0)
public static boolean
a(String arg0)
isValidUsername(String arg0)
method_40085(String arg0)
m_iulkoyog(String arg0)
isValidName(String name)
isValidUsername(String username)
m_203792_(String p_203793_)
public void
a(zy arg0)
handleKey(ServerboundKeyPacket arg0)
method_12642(class_2917 arg0)
m_skkbjfvk(C_rcidxqma arg0)
onKey(LoginKeyC2SPacket arg0)
onKey(LoginKeyC2SPacket arg0)
m_8072_(C_5212_ arg0)
public void
a(zw arg0)
handleCustomQueryPacket(ServerboundCustomQueryPacket arg0)
method_12640(class_2913 arg0)
m_ahchzdem(C_pqwhxkcu arg0)
onQueryResponse(LoginQueryResponseC2SPacket arg0)
onQueryResponse(LoginQueryResponseC2SPacket arg0)
m_7223_(C_5210_ arg0)
protected com.mojang.authlib.GameProfile
a(com.mojang.authlib.GameProfile arg0)
createFakeProfile(com.mojang.authlib.GameProfile arg0)
method_14375(com.mojang.authlib.GameProfile arg0)
m_eiobxqoi(com.mojang.authlib.GameProfile arg0)
toOfflineProfile(com.mojang.authlib.GameProfile profile)
toOfflineProfile(com.mojang.authlib.GameProfile profile)
m_10038_(com.mojang.authlib.GameProfile arg0)